Dillon’s Environmental Sciences technical group is looking for Biologists and/or Project Managers to join our multidisciplinary team of professionals. You will have the opportunity to work on new and exciting projects while providing clients with a fully integrated and superior customer experience.
This position location is open to our GTHA office locations (Toronto, Kitchener, Guelph, Oakville, or Hamilton). Remote or flexible work arrangements will also be considered.
We work with all levels of government, including Indigenous communities, industry and resource developers in the areas of environmental assessment, planning, and management. The successful candidate(s) will support our team with key tasks including: environmental permitting, approvals and compliance; leadership in environmental regulatory affairs interactions; contributing to environmental reports, plans, and monitoring programs. Dillon offers a flexible, collaborative work environment with career growth and advancement opportunities. The ideal candidate(s) is/are a passionate and motivated individual with relevant experience leading land development and/or environmental assessment (EA) projects, and a team-player attitude.
